Defendants and judges enter courtroom and Prosecutor Ervin reads indictment during war crimes trials in Nuremberg, Germany.

War crimes trials (Flick Case) in Nuremberg, Germany. Defendants enter courtroom and take their places in prisoner's dock. Defendants include Hermann Terberger, Bernhard Weiss, Konard Kaletsch, Otto Steinbrinck and Freidrich Flick. People in courtroom rise as judges William C Christianson, Frank N. Richman, Charles B Sears, and Richard D Dixon enter. U.S. flag in the background. The judges ask that the prosecutor read the indictment. Prosecutor Thomas E Ervin reads the indictment. Ervin states that workers were subject to inhuman treatment while employed in German factories.

Airmen work on a Douglas World Cruiser and Lt. Smith superintends unpacking of a new engine in England.

U.S. Army Air Service Douglas World Cruisers (DWC) in London during their first flight around the world. In Brough, England airmen work on one of the world cruiser at a rapid pace preparing for a hop to the Orkney Islands and first lap across the Atlantic. A world cruiser maintenance man cleans the aircraft. Lieutenant Lowell H. Smith, pilot of the world cruiser, superintends unpacking of a new engine for his airplane. Several views of the engine changeover. The engines start. Ground crew members push pontoons. Several views of the replacing of wheels on pontoons.
